    Had another look under Patrol as whine is still there at 100 klms, I can only turn the front prop 1/4 turn by hand , does this mean it is locked in ?

    Jack your front wheels of the ground and then try turning your prop shaft discount your hubs first as it cheaper than your transfer case to rebuild.
